p566m1426542 - RS - United Kingdom; UK; Scotland; Edinburgh; Great Britain; British Isles; Palace of Holyroodhouse

ID p566m1426542
Title United Kingdom; UK; Scotland; Edinburgh; Great Britain; British Isles; Palace of Holyroodhouse
Credit plainpicture/Mato/Guido Cozzi
License Rights Simplified (RS)
Releases Model Release: No
Property Release: No
Maximum version
  • 52 MB
  • 5158x3524 px
  • 17.2x11.7 in
  • 300 dpi